""Three Live Ghosts"" is a comedic play written by Frederic Stewart Isham and first published in 1918. The story revolves around three British soldiers who are presumed dead during World War I but actually survive and are stranded on a deserted island. They eventually make their way back to London, only to find that their families have all moved on and their estates have been sold. The three soldiers decide to pose as ghosts to scare off the new occupants of their former homes, but their plan goes awry when they encounter a group of German spies.
